In May 2023 As part of a community service project, a professor organized a field trip to a public school in Brooklyn aimed at promoting oral health and healthy living habits among children. The trip focused on educating the kids and their parents about the benefits of proper oral hygiene and good nutrition.

During the field trip, a group of children went through a series of interactive activities focused on oral health, including brushing techniques, the importance of regular dental check-ups, and the benefits of fluoride varnish application. I also worked with the school administration to organize a presentation for parents focused on the link between oral health and overall health, emphasizing the importance of a balanced diet and regular exercise.
